Original Description
Jan Gossaert’s Maria Magdalena (c. 1525) is a mesmerizing blend of Northern Renaissance precision and Italianate grace, capturing the saint in a moment of contemplative beauty. The painting’s luminous skin tones, intricate drapery folds, and delicate landscape background reflect Gossaert’s mastery of oil techniques and his synthesis of Flemish detail with Renaissance idealism. Magdalena’s poised demeanor, holding her iconic ointment jar, exudes quiet devotion, while the soft chiaroscuro lends her figure an almost sculptural depth. As a pivotal artist bridging late Gothic and Renaissance styles, Gossaert’s work represents the cultural exchange between the Netherlands and Italy. This piece, though less prolific than his mythological scenes, is a testament to his ability to infuse sacred subjects with both solemnity and human warmth, making it a significant study in early 16th-century Netherlandish art.
